    Gloria Victis ("glory to the vanquished") is a sculpture by Antonin Mercié. Many casts, with different finishes, exist of the group. That pictured here is seen at the National Gallery of Art in Washington DC. Another example of the statue can be found in Bordeaux, France, where it faces Saint André's Cathedral.

    Fame, also called Gloria Victis ("Glory to the Defeated" or "Glory to the Conquered"), [1] is a Confederate monument in Salisbury, North Carolina.Cast in Brussels, in 1891, Fame is one of two nearly-identical sculptures by Frederick Ruckstull (the other being the Confederate Soldiers and Sailors Monument, removed from public display in Baltimore in 2017).

    The Gloria Victis monument comprises a limestone column supporting Mercié's sculpture which depicts an "Angel of Victory" who supports a mortally injured soldier. Symbolically the soldier's sword is broken. The simple inscription reads "Gloria Victis" which translates to "Glory to the vanquished". Even in defeat there is honour and glory!

    The statue shows Glory supporting a fallen soldier, his standard lowered but her wreath of History held high. The inscription at the base of the monument read, "GLORIA VICTIS", meaning "Glory to the Vanquished" [2] and To The Soldiers and Sailors of Maryland in the Service of The Confederate States of America, 1861–1865.
